Hi. New here so please bear with me. I bought a Lone Star 15 footer with an Evinrude Lark 35 outboard. We noticed a lot of funny looking stuff in the fuel bowl, so removed the carb to clean it. The float is made or covered with of some odd material that is deteriorating and needs to be replaced. The serial and model numbers from the engine plate read like this;<br />Evinrude<br />35517<br />13633<br />Can anyone help me determine the year of this engine and help me find a place online where I can easily find and order a replacement float, carburetor repair kit and a few other small items to get this engine running again. 35517 = 1959<br />Not sure about the parts but someone once reference a place that had a lot off those old parts.

You can get a carb kit, with a new plastic float from any Johnnyrude dealer. They may have to order it, but it's available. Someone will come along shortly with a part number for you. I don't have it handy.
